Is CCC Examination compulsory for Government Job?

Hello friends,

I have recently joined Government Public Library in Gujarat. And all of us (Newly joined staff) have to clear CCC (Course on Computer Concepts) Examination within a limited period.

As per my knowledge CCC is required only for those who have not studied Computer as a subject in SSC / HSC or in Higher Education.....    For those having computer as a subject in SSC or  HSC or at College Level do not require CCC.

To clear my doubt I need following Gazette copy.

Title in English  -  "Gujarat Civil Services Computer Training and Examination Rules-2006"

Title in Gujarati  -   "Computer Kaushalya ane Pariksha Niyamo - 2006"

Please upload it to the forum ... or please comment if you have further information..

CCC should not be compulsory for library post because we  have already, computer as a subject at UG& PG level and our nature of job is different to clerical job, but government recognized us as a clerical cadre job.Our professional associations should represent the matter and do the needful.....................

If any Govt. or local body issue a circular it is legal and binding unless it is withdrawn of quashed by competent court.

Here is the Gujrat Govt . order regarding CCC which is binding at your end.Download it.
